Ayden - Grifton's game last Saturday was a loss, but they didn't let that memory haunt them on Tuesday. They s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 4-3 win over the SouthWest Edgecombe Cougars. For the Chargers, this counts as revenge for the 4-2 victory the Cougars walked away with the last time they faced one another back in April of 2024.
Parker Roland was incredible, going 2-for-3 with one home run and two RBI. That's the most hits he has posted since back in March.

Ayden - Grifton pushed their record up to 12-4 with the win, which was their fourth straight at home. They've had to fight for that success though, as they only beat their opponents by an average of two runs across that stretch. As for SouthWest Edgecombe,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 10-3.
Ayden - Grifton will have a chance to go back-to-back against the Cougars: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day.
